Who is Dairy Queen owned by?
Dairy Queen (DQ) is an American chain of soft serve ice cream and fast-food restaurants owned by International Dairy Queen, Inc. (a subsidiary of Berkshire Hathaway) which also owns Orange Julius, and formerly owned Karmelkorn and Golden Skillet Fried Chicken. Its corporate offices are in Bloomington, Minnesota.

Who bought DQ?
Warren Buffett’s Berkshire Hathaway Inc.
Warren Buffett’s Berkshire Hathaway Inc. on Tuesday agreed to buy International Dairy Queen Inc. for $585 million in cash and stock, adding the ice cream and hamburger chain to a portfolio stuffed with insurance, candy, shoe and newspaper holdings.

How much money do I need to open a Dairy Queen?
Dairy Queen Franchise Cost / Initial Investment / Income The franchise fee for a Dairy Queen restaurant is $25,000 to $35,000. The total estimated investment ranges from $382,000 to $1.8 million, with liquid cash available of $400,000. A 4-5% royalty fee on gross monthly receipts is paid to the company.

How much did Berkshire Hathaway pay for Dairy Queen?
Omaha-based Berkshire will pay $27 a share in cash or $26 in either of its two classes of stock for each Class A and Class B share of Dairy Queen, whose roots date to 1939, when a Green River, Ill., ice cream maker joined forces with a refrigerator inventor.
What is the history of Dairy Queen?
Dairy Queen got its start when J.F. McCullough invented a machine for making soft ice cream in 1938 and named it after his cow. A year later, McCullough joined with Harry Oltz, who invented a way to keep ice cream at a constant temperature. They sold franchisees the right to use the machines and collected royalties on the gallons of ice cream sold.
